Subject: ProctorQueue key rotation — heads up for the sync

Hey all — quick note before Thursday. We rotated the credentials for the ProctorQueue intake service after the Fenwick audit flagged the old key as over-scoped. Exam session events kept flowing during the swap, so no student impact, but any local scripts polling the queue directly will start 401ing today. Update your configs before the old key dies Friday noon. For the internal intake endpoint, use the new key below.

API key for tagug-tajef: vxb4-R1fo

Re: Retirement of the Stonebriar product line

Stonebriar sales have declined for five consecutive quarters and support costs now exceed contribution margin. The retirement plan is staged: new orders close end of Q2, existing contracts honoured through their terms, and spares stocked for twenty-four months. Sales leads should steer prospects toward the Ashgrove range; migration incentives are already approved. Customer comms are drafted and awaiting legal sign-off. The forward strategy behind this decision is set out in the note below.

confidential, yafog-hagug: Gross margin on Druix came in at 10 percent against a plan of 15 percent. Only 5 of the 80 pilot accounts renewed Druix, so a churn review is set for October 1.

* The report grid relies on a stable sort so rows with equal
 * primary keys keep their ingestion order across exports. Our
 * previous comparator delegated to the platform sort, which is
 * not guaranteed stable on all runtimes, and customers noticed
 * rows shuffling between otherwise identical PDF exports. This
 * constant defines the secondary tiebreak key applied after the
 * user-selected column. Do not remove it, even if tests pass
 * locally. The regression was first isolated in the build whose
 * token is noted below. */

trace token, bagug-tadup: htk6_fc0fc4